int main()
{
int i = 0;
int count = 0;
for (i = 100; i <= 200; i++)
{
int j = 0;
for (j = 2; j < i; j++)
{
if (i%j == 0)
{
break;
}
}
if (i == j)
{
printf("%d ", i);
count++;
}
}
printf("\n共有%d个质数\n", count);
system("pause");
return 0;
}
日精进今天做了几道简单的C的基础题,看了一篇求质数不同境界的n种方法这篇文章,我充分明白到哪怕是为了达到最基本的目的,我们也有不同的路径去实现去选择。下面是我练习的时候输入的第一段代码int main(){ int i = 0; int count = 0; for (i = 100; i &lt;= 200; i++) { int j = 0; for (j = 2; j ...